Optimize Your Google My Business Listing

The first step is ensuring your GMB profile is fully optimized. Fill out every detail: accurate business name, address, phone number (NAP consistency), categories, and services. Upload high-quality, relevant photos that showcase your offerings. Remember, Google favors complete profiles, so don’t leave anything blank. Build a Strong Local Citation Profile

Local citations are mentions of your business across the web—listings on directories, review sites, and local platforms. Consistency is key; ensure your NAP details match exactly across all citations. I used a tool to audit my citations and found discrepancies, which I then corrected. Gather and Manage Positive Reviews

Reviews influence rankings and consumer trust. Encourage satisfied customers to leave detailed reviews on your GMB profile. Respond promptly to all reviews, especially negative ones, to show engagement. I implemented a follow-up email requesting reviews, which increased my review count by 30% in two months. Myth: More Keywords Always Mean Better Rankings

One pervasive misconception is that stuffing your website and GMB posts with as many Boise-specific keywords as possible will boost your local rankings. However, search engines favor quality and relevance over keyword density. Over-optimization can even trigger penalties, making your rankings drop instead of rise. Beware of the Local Citation Trap

Many overlook the importance of citation consistency. While building citations is essential, having inconsistent NAP details across directories can severely hurt your rankings. Incorrect addresses or phone numbers send confusing signals to Google and can prevent your business from appearing in the top 3. Advanced Question: How Does Google Really Decide the Top 3 in Boise?

Google’s ranking algorithm considers several factors beyond just citations and reviews. It evaluates user engagement signals, proximity, relevance, and even behavioral factors like click-through rates. Recent studies suggest that local search results are increasingly personalized based on user intent and context. Ignoring these nuances can leave you behind.
